The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 is a lot better than Lenovo Yoga Tablet 10 HD+, getting a global score of 74.6 against 60.4. These tablets come with the same Android 4.4 OS (Operating System), so you shouldn't perceive any difference regarding operating system features. Even though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 and the Lenovo Yoga Tablet 10 HD+ were only released 2 months apart,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1's body is notably thicker but also notably lighter than the Lenovo Yoga Tablet 10 HD+.
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 features a little better performance than Lenovo Yoga Tablet 10 HD+, and although they both have a Quad-Core processor and 2 GB of RAM, the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 also has an extra GPU. The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 counts with a better looking screen than Lenovo Yoga Tablet 10 HD+, and although they both have a same size screen, the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 also has a higher pixel density and a higher resolution of 1600 x 2560.
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 takes a bit better photos and videos than Lenovo Yoga Tablet 10 HD+. Both have a back camera with an 8 megapixels resolution.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 features as much memory to install applications and games as Lenovo Yoga Tablet 10 HD+, they have a SD extension slot that supports a maximum of 64 GB and the same internal storage capacity.
The Lenovo Yoga Tablet 10 HD+ counts with just a little bit longer battery lifetime than Samsung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1, because it has a 9% greater battery size.
The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 costs a bit more money than Lenovo Yoga Tablet 10 HD+, but it's still a convenient choice, as you can get a lot more for that extra money.
